Rasche Property Claims

The Rasche Property Claims is a silver mine located in Custer county, Idaho at an elevation of 8,199 feet.

Analytical Data: ORE CONTAINS 50-200 OZ AG/TON


Materials

Ore: Galena
Gangue: Pyrrhotite
Gangue: Epidote
Gangue: Quartz


Comments

Comment (Location): Upper Baldwin Creek

Comment (Deposit): Property Was Visited In 1982 By USBM River of No Return (Wilderness) Crew. 8 Samples Were Taken WRL 72-79. See Mineral Property File For Sample Tags, Underground Mine Map, and Sample Location Map.
